Apache Beam
Un modelo unificado para definir y ejecutar canalizaciones de procesamiento de datos
Apache Beam proporciona un modelo de programación unificado avanzado, que te permite implementar trabajos de procesamiento de datos por lotes y de transmisión que pueden ejecutarse en cualquier motor de ejecución. Es fácil de usar con Apache Apex, Apache Flink, Apache Spark y Google Cloud Dataflow, entre otros backends de procesamiento distribuido.
Apache Beam se desarrolló a partir de varias tecnologías internas de Google, como MapReduce, FlumeJava y Millwheel. Google donó el código a la Apache Software Foundation en 2016, y los Googlers siguen contribuyendo con regularidad al proyecto.
Apache, Apache Beam y el logotipo con la letra B naranja son marcas registradas o marcas de Apache Software Foundation en Estados Unidos o en otros países.
Cómo Google usa Apache Beam
Apache Beam es un sucesor de código abierto de los SDK que se usan internamente para potenciar la mayoría de las canalizaciones de procesamiento de datos de escala masiva de Google.
-
Repo
-
Licencia
-
Categorías
-
Idiomas